Allowably is an adverb.
The adverb is an invariable part of the sentence that can change, explain or simplify a verb or another adverb.

WHAT DOES ALLOWABLY MEAN IN ENGLISH?

Definition of allowably in the English dictionary

The definition of allowably in the dictionary is in a way that is allowable.
